The NA Standing Committee on Science, Education, Culture, Diaspora, Youth and Sport debated the draft law on Making Addenda and Amendments to the Law on Scientific and Scientific-Technical Activity at the extraordinary sitting in the second reading on May 3.
According to the RA Minister of Education, Science, Culture and Sport Zhanna Andreasyan, there were two written proposals by the deputy Narek Babayan during the period from the first to the second reading. They referred to the definition of the grounds for terminating the authority of a person appointed to the position of Head of a scientific organization or chosen as a result of an election: the proposals were adopted by the Government and added to the draft law.
The Minister mentioned that as a result of the debates, before the second reading, clauses 2, 3, 4 of Article 4, which referred to the National Academy of Sciences, were removed from the draft law. She informed that some editorial amendments were also made.
The Committee endorsed the draft law.
